Choosing the Right Clinic: A Step-by-Step Guide
Selecting the optimal weight loss program is a personal process. Follow these steps to make an informed decision:
Thorough Research: Investigate the websites of multiple clinics. Note any missing information, as this could be a red flag. Look for independent reviews but remember that subjectivity can influence these assessments.
Schedule Consultations: Arrange initial consultations with several clinics. This allows you to ask detailed questions and assess the staff and approach of each clinic.
Compare and Contrast: After your consultations, compare the costs, support systems, medications (if any), and overall philosophy of each clinic. Weigh the advantages and disadvantages carefully.
Due Diligence: Seek out independent reviews online but maintain a critical perspective. If possible, try to connect with previous patients (while respecting their privacy) to obtain diverse viewpoints.
Doctor's Approval: Before starting any program, consult your primary care physician. They can assess potential risks and ensure the program aligns with your individual health needs. This is crucial for safety and efficacy.
Crucial Questions for Potential Weight-Loss Clinics
Your consultations are vital for obtaining clear answers. Don’t hesitate to ask these questions:
- What specific medications, if any, will be used, and what are the potential side effects?
- What's the complete cost breakdown, including any hidden fees or extra charges?
- What ongoing support will I receive beyond the initial treatment phase, and what's the long-term plan?
- How will my progress be monitored, and what are realistic weight loss and maintenance expectations?
- What percentage of your patients successfully achieved and maintained their weight loss goals? (While respecting patient privacy, can you provide general success rate data?)
Understanding Potential Risks
Weight loss programs, regardless of their effectiveness, present potential risks. These can include ineffective treatment, medication side effects, difficulty maintaining lifestyle changes, unforeseen financial burdens, and a lack of sustained support after the initial program. Thorough research and insightful questioning can mitigate these risks.
